#279e6a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#279e6a is composed of 15.3% red, 62% green and 41.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.9%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 153.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 38.6%. #279e6a color hex could be obtained by blending #4effd4 with #003d00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#279e6a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f0fb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#279e6a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c6963 is the less saturated color, while #01c46f is the most saturated one.
